South African sprinters showcased impressive form at recent Diamond League events in Lausanne and Silesia. Sinesipho Dambile, Gift Leotlela, Akani Simbine, and Zakithi Nene all contributed to the strong showing, demonstrating the nation’s growing strength in sprint events. Their performances highlight a significant depth of talent within South African athletics. The athletes delivered consistently strong results across both competitions, signaling a promising future for South African sprinting on the international stage.
